Windham won the last time they faced South Portland and things went their way on Tuesday too. The Windham Eagles sure made it a nail-biter, but they managed to escape with a 35-33 victory over the South Portland Red Riots.
Windham now has a winning record of 5-4. As for South Portland, with the defeat, they broke their five-game winning streak and moved their record to 8-2.
Both teams are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. It'll be Battle of the Birds when the Windham Eagles duke it out with the Marshwood Hawks at 6:00 p.m. on Thursday. As for South Portland, they will face off against Oxford Hills at 1:00 p.m. on Saturday.
